**Action item (P2):** The Sketchloom undo stack kept deleted shapes — including ones pasted from restricted boards — in plaintext memory indefinitely. We'll cap history depth and scrub entries on board close. Redo buffers get the same treatment. Worth a security pass before we ship. The proposed retention rules are written up on the internal page.

runbook for hawif-tajeg: https://grafana.plorvasoft.example/dash

## Watchdog Overview

Kioskette runs a watchdog service, Perchguard, that restarts the shell if heartbeats stop for 30 seconds. It runs as an unprivileged account, reads only the heartbeat socket, and cannot modify application binaries. Restart events are signed and shipped to the audit log within one minute. Tampering with the heartbeat file triggers lockdown mode. Review the service manifest before approving changes. Report findings or concerns to the platform owner at the address below.

alerts address for faduf-yajeg: drumir@nelvroworks.internal

## Formula sandbox tuning

User-supplied formulas in Gridmoor execute inside a restricted interpreter with hard ceilings on time, memory, and call depth. Reviewers should confirm any change to these ceilings is justified in the PR description, since raising them widens the abuse surface. Defaults were chosen from production traces. The current limits are as follows.

limits module of tafog-fawip:
WEIGHTS = {
    "julix": 57,
    "lamys": 992,
    "kasvan": 209,
    "quenok": 750,
    "alddor": 259,
    "oliath": 1009,
    "wenix": 815,
}

Handover — Annual Billing Transition

To the incoming director: Pellarch Software shifts all subscriptions to annual billing effective next fiscal year. Monthly plans close to new signups in March. Migration discounts approved for legacy accounts; churn modeling done by the Ralbeck team, worst case 6%. Finance tooling update is mid-build — chase the Ardenfold group weekly or it slips. Renewal comms drafted, not sent. Legal cleared terms. Everything else is in the shared tracker. One last item follows below, and it stays between us.

board note of kagaf-tahog: Ulaoxek Systems is in early talks to buy Ralokek Group for about $329.6 million. The Wenys launch date is September 16, and nothing goes to the press before then. Legal wants the Keloxox Foods term sheet signed before June 7.